Any insurers out there that allow you to race your vehicle and have reasonably priced coverage? I have a mostly street driven vehicle but would like to make the occasional trip down the track each summer. I got a good quote from grundy but they won't allow racing. Thanks.

I don't know of any insurance company that will cover damage done on a race track ? Tell them it's a show car and not a race car. Most insurance companies will cancel you if they find out your car is on a race track. A word of advice, I would never go down the track with a license plate on the car. There are spotters that will turn you in to the insurance company and they will cancel you.

AO Underwriters DOES insure the car on track, off track in storage whatever. They also are pretty prompt with payment if there is an incident. I know of two people who have had thier cars destroyed you were promptly paid on thier claim. The insurance is from Lloyds of London and AO are the underwriters.
